Would I be able to get some type of driving permit in one state until I get reinstated in another state?

Asked on Nov 02nd, 2013 on DUI/DWI - Texas
More details to this question:
I served a 3-year revocation in Illinois for two DUI from 07-10. I have had a restricted driving permit in IL with the interlock device for 2 years. I have a job offer in Texas that would require me to drive around the state. Would I be able to get some type of driving permit in Texas until I get reinstated in Illinois? I know I can’t get an actual license in Texas until I am fully cleared in Illinois.

You can apply for an occupational driving privilege in Texas by filing a petition in a County Court at Law in the county where you live. See a Texas lawyer, and good luck.
